PGA Tour News: Wesley Bryan Announces New Breakaway Tour

In a groundbreaking announcement that could ripple through the golfing community, former PGA Tour player Wesley Bryan has unveiled plans for a new breakaway golf tour. This tour will feature a staggering £750,000 prize for its winner, raising eyebrows and sparking conversations about the future of competitive golf. Bryan’s decision comes at a time when debates about player compensation and the direction of professional golf are more relevant than ever.

Official Details

The news comes directly from Wesley Bryan, who has been a notable player on the PGA Tour before facing challenges that led to a hiatus from competitive play. Bryan’s new venture aims to attract golfers looking for alternative opportunities outside of the traditional PGA framework. While specific tournament dates and locations have yet to be confirmed, Bryan’s enthusiastic pitch suggests a format that promises to be innovative and enticing for both players and fans alike.
